Sight no further than my hands
Cold, damp clouds my view.
Shaking, shiver, sodden
Hazy, grey outlines of trees.

Looming creature, vicious
Intents. Coming closer,
Frigid dread incapacitates.
No escape, no hope.

Unforeseen light fills my sight
A torch of hope.
Horrendous monster gone,
Yet I’m still alone.

Sitting in the damp, darkness
Many years I will spend
Holding on to my little hope
Fighting the creatures of dark.


The author's comments:

This poem is about a person stuck in a foggy forest. She is alone when a creatre attacks her. When all hope was lost she was suddenly given light which scared off the creature. This is a metaphor for someone who is depressed and has lost all hope when suddenly something enters into their life to give it meaning again.
